How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Richfield?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Richfield Studio Apartments | $1,503 | $825 | $3,919 |
Richfield 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,632 | $795 | $3,429 |
Richfield 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,954 | $1,000 | $4,171 |
Richfield 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,180 | $1,200 | $3,850 |
Richfield 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,100 | $4,100 | $4,100 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Richfield
How much are Studio apartments in Richfield?
There are currently 23 Studio Apartments in Richfield with rent ranges from $825 to $3,919 with an average price of $1,503.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Richfield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Richfield ranges from $795 to $3,429 with an average monthly rent of $1,632.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Richfield c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Richfield range from $1,000 to $4,171.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,954.
How expensive are Richfield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 61 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Richfield on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,200 to $3,850 - averaging $2,180 for the location.
